To investigate the damage characteristics of supercavitating projectiles against underwater structures, we conducted a simulation study of a 12.7 mm supercavitating projectile impacting typical targets at different speeds. The reliability of the simulation model was verified based on experimental results, and a detailed analysis of the projectile-target penetration characteristics under full water conditions was performed. The results show that compared to the unreinforced curved target, the ballistic limit velocity of the weakest unreinforced part of the reinforced curved target increased by 3.1%, and the surface depression caused by water load squeezing decreased by 27.3%. As the projectile velocity increases, the energy absorption ratio of the target plate before penetration increases to varying degrees, but the unreinforced curved target is most affected by the water load before penetration. Under the same projectile velocity, the reinforced curved target effectively restrained the overall deformation of the target plate, but its crack growth energy consumption was greater than that of the unreinforced curved target, leading to a deeper crack propagation along the target thickness. The higher the projectile velocity is, the narrower the crack extension around the hole is, indicating reduced crack growth energy consumption, with bending energy dissipation becoming dominant. The results can offer guidance for the design of underwater structures.

为探究超空泡射弹对水下耐压结构的毁伤特性,本文开展了12.7 mm超空泡射弹在不同速度下撞击典型靶(无筋曲靶和加筋曲靶)的仿真研究。本研究基于实验结果验证了仿真模型的可靠性,详细分析了全水下侵彻的弹道响应特性,揭示了水下侵彻无筋曲靶的损伤机理,并阐明了弹−靶的动态响应关系和加筋结构的抗侵彻特性。结果表明:相较于无筋曲靶,加筋曲靶最薄弱的无筋部位的弹道极限速度提高了3.1%,流体载荷挤压所致的表面凹陷面积减小了27.3%,随着射弹速度增大,两种典型金属靶的侵前吸能比均有不同程度的增长,但无筋曲靶的侵前吸能比上升速率更快。在相同射弹速度下,加强筋有效抑制了加筋曲靶的整体变形,但其裂纹生长耗能比无筋曲靶更大,因此裂纹沿靶厚方向的扩展深度也更大。射弹速度越大,两种典型靶的孔周裂纹延伸范围均越小,说明射弹速度的上升降低了靶板的裂纹生长耗能。研究结果可为水下耐压结构设计提供参考。
